
React è la nostra principale libreria frontend. Realizziamo applicazioni web interattive e performanti utilizzando React 19 — Server Components, Suspense, Actions e il compiler. Dalle dashboard interne alle piattaforme rivolte ai clienti, React garantisce interfacce manutenibili, testabili e scalabili.
React è una libreria JavaScript per costruire interfacce utente tramite componenti riutilizzabili. Creata da Meta, alimenta Facebook, Instagram, WhatsApp Web e migliaia di altre applicazioni. React 19 ha introdotto i Server Components, le Actions e un compiler che ottimizza automaticamente le prestazioni di rendering.
Per le aziende, React offre l'ecosistema più vasto di qualsiasi libreria frontend — più componenti, più sviluppatori, più risorse di apprendimento, più candidati. Il suo modello a componenti si integra naturalmente con i design system, rendendo efficiente la collaborazione tra designer e sviluppatori. E il suo flusso di dati unidirezionale rende le applicazioni prevedibili e debuggabili a qualsiasi scala.
Realizziamo ogni frontend con React, principalmente attraverso Next.js. Le nostre librerie di componenti sono progettate per essere riutilizzate tra i progetti — pulsanti, moduli, navigazione e visualizzazioni di dati che mantengono la coerenza visiva adattandosi al brand di ciascun cliente. Il modello a componenti di React ci permette di fornire funzionalità in modo incrementale senza interrompere ciò che già funziona.
Per le aziende che costruiscono applicazioni web, React è la scelta più sicura a lungo termine per lo sviluppo frontend. Il suo ecosistema garantisce che Lei troverà sempre sviluppatori in grado di lavorare sulla Sua codebase, componenti che risolvono problemi comuni e strumenti che continuano a migliorare. Sfruttiamo i Server Components di React per offrire caricamenti iniziali rapidi mantenendo l'interattività ricca che gli utenti moderni si aspettano.

I componenti React sono unità autonome di UI che combinano markup, logica e styling. Si crea un componente pulsante una volta e lo si utilizza ovunque. Questa coerenza riduce i bug e accelera lo sviluppo in applicazioni di grandi dimensioni.
I Server Components di React 19 vengono eseguiti sul server, inviando zero JavaScript al browser. Li utilizziamo per pagine ricche di dati — elenchi di prodotti, indici di blog, dashboard — riducendo il JavaScript lato client del 30-50%.
L'ecosistema di React include migliaia di librerie testate in produzione — gestione dello stato (Zustand, Jotai), moduli (React Hook Form), animazioni (Framer Motion), recupero dati (TanStack Query). Selezioniamo strumenti comprovati invece di costruire da zero.
Il modello a componenti di React, l'integrazione con TypeScript e l'ecosistema di testing (Testing Library, Vitest) rendono le codebase manutenibili nel corso degli anni. I team si integrano più velocemente perché i pattern di React sono standardizzati in tutto il settore.
Dashboard interattive con dati in tempo reale, tabelle filtrabili, grafici e viste basate sui ruoli. Il modello a componenti di React gestisce la gestione complessa dello stato richiesta dalle dashboard.
Cataloghi prodotti, ricerca con risultati istantanei, carrelli con aggiornamenti ottimistici e flussi di checkout. Le prestazioni di rendering di React garantiscono esperienze di acquisto fluide.
Portali rivolti ai clienti dove gli utenti gestiscono account, visualizzano fatture, inviano ticket di supporto e monitorano lo stato dei progetti. I componenti React rispecchiano in modo pulito i modelli di dati backend.
Siti di marketing e piattaforme di contenuti dove i Server Components garantiscono caricamenti iniziali rapidi mentre React lato client gestisce sezioni interattive — moduli, caroselli, player video.
React è il livello UI della nostra architettura full-stack, connesso ai backend e alle API attraverso interfacce ben definite.
Nessun impegno. Dicci cosa ti serve e ti diremo come lo risolveremmo.
React offre l'ecosistema più vasto, l'architettura più flessibile e il più ampio bacino di talenti. Vue.js è eccellente per applicazioni più piccole. Angular si adatta a grandi team aziendali. Raccomandiamo React per la maggior parte dei progetti perché scala da siti semplici ad applicazioni complesse senza cambiamenti di framework.
I Server Components fanno parte di ogni progetto Next.js che realizziamo. Gestiscono il recupero dei dati, le query al database e il rendering dei contenuti sul server — inviando solo HTML al browser. Questo riduce la dimensione del bundle JavaScript e migliora significativamente le prestazioni di caricamento della pagina.
Utilizziamo lo strumento più semplice che si adatta: useState e useContext integrati in React per lo stato locale e condiviso, Zustand per lo stato globale dell'applicazione e TanStack Query per lo stato del server (caching e sincronizzazione dei dati API). Evitiamo Redux a meno che il progetto non lo richieda specificamente.
Rileviamo regolarmente progetti React da altri team o agenzie. Il nostro processo include un audit della codebase, revisione delle dipendenze, valutazione delle prestazioni e un piano di miglioramento prioritizzato. Identifichiamo vittorie rapide e miglioramenti strutturali per rimettere il progetto in carreggiata.
Realizziamo applicazioni React veloci, manutenibili e progettate per crescere con la Sua azienda.
Consulenza gratuita · Audit del codice disponibile · TypeScript-first